新聞中心
Oracle 12c入門教程,幫助你快速掌握數(shù)據(jù)庫管理技能,提高工作效率。
Oracle 12c入門讓你快速上手
Oracle 12c是甲骨文公司推出的一款關(guān)系型數(shù)據(jù)庫管理系統(tǒng),它是目前市場上最流行的數(shù)據(jù)庫之一,本文將為您介紹如何快速上手Oracle 12c,幫助您更好地理解和使用這款強(qiáng)大的數(shù)據(jù)庫管理系統(tǒng)。
安裝Oracle 12c
1、系統(tǒng)要求:Oracle 12c支持多種操作系統(tǒng),包括Windows、Linux和Solaris等,在安裝之前,請確保您的計(jì)算機(jī)滿足以下硬件和軟件要求:
至少4GB的內(nèi)存
至少10GB的可用硬盤空間
支持64位操作系統(tǒng)
網(wǎng)絡(luò)連接
2、下載Oracle 12c安裝包:訪問Oracle官方網(wǎng)站,根據(jù)您的操作系統(tǒng)選擇相應(yīng)的安裝包進(jìn)行下載。
3、安裝Oracle 12c:運(yùn)行下載的安裝包,按照提示完成安裝過程,在安裝過程中,您需要設(shè)置Oracle基目錄、端口號(hào)等信息。
創(chuàng)建數(shù)據(jù)庫實(shí)例
1、啟動(dòng)SQL*Plus工具:在命令行中輸入“sqlplus”并按回車鍵,進(jìn)入SQL*Plus工具。
2、連接到數(shù)據(jù)庫:在SQL*Plus中輸入用戶名和密碼,然后輸入“connect sys/sys_password as sysdba”并按回車鍵,連接到數(shù)據(jù)庫。
3、創(chuàng)建數(shù)據(jù)庫實(shí)例:在SQL*Plus中輸入以下命令,創(chuàng)建一個(gè)名為“orcl”的數(shù)據(jù)庫實(shí)例:
CREATE DATABASE orcl
USER ID sys identified by sys_password
FILE_NAME_CONVERT = ('/dbfs/oracle/oradata/orcl/', '/dbfs/oracle/oradata/orcl/')
LOGFILE_GROUP_1 ('/dbfs/oracle/redologs/orcl/redo01.log') SIZE 50M,
GROUP 1 ('/dbfs/oracle/redologs/orcl/redo02.log') SIZE 50M,
GROUP 2 ('/dbfs/oracle/redologs/orcl/redo03.log') SIZE 50M;
創(chuàng)建表空間和用戶
1、創(chuàng)建表空間:在SQL*Plus中輸入以下命令,創(chuàng)建一個(gè)名為“users”的表空間:
CREATE TABLESPACE users
DATAFILE 'users.dbf'
SIZE 100M
AUTOEXTEND ON;
2、創(chuàng)建用戶:在SQL*Plus中輸入以下命令,創(chuàng)建一個(gè)名為“user1”的用戶,并將其指定到“users”表空間:
CREATE USER user1 IDENTIFIED BY user1_password
DEFAULT TABLESPACE users;
導(dǎo)入數(shù)據(jù)
1、創(chuàng)建數(shù)據(jù)文件:在SQL*Plus中輸入以下命令,創(chuàng)建一個(gè)名為“users.dbf”的數(shù)據(jù)文件:
CREATE TABLE users (id NUMBER(5), name VARCHAR2(50))
PCTFREE 10 PCTUSED 40 INITRANS 10 NOCOMPRESS NOLOGGING;
2、插入數(shù)據(jù):在SQL*Plus中輸入以下命令,向“users”表中插入一條數(shù)據(jù):
INSERT INTO users (id, name) VALUES (1, '張三');
常見問題與解答
問題1:安裝Oracle 12c時(shí)遇到“ORA-XXXXX”錯(cuò)誤怎么辦?
答:請查閱Oracle官方文檔或在線社區(qū),查找對應(yīng)的錯(cuò)誤代碼和解決方案,檢查您的操作系統(tǒng)和硬件配置是否滿足Oracle 12c的要求。
問題2:如何修改Oracle用戶的密碼?
答:可以使用ALTER USER命令修改用戶的密碼,ALTER USER user1 IDENTIFIED BY new_password;。
問題3:如何備份和恢復(fù)Oracle數(shù)據(jù)庫?
答:可以使用RMAN(Recovery Manager)工具進(jìn)行備份和恢復(fù)操作,使用RMAN創(chuàng)建備份集;使用RMAN進(jìn)行恢復(fù)操作,具體操作方法請參考Oracle官方文檔。
分享名稱:Oracle12c入門讓你快速上手
文章地址:http://www.dlmjj.cn/article/cccgpoo.html


咨詢
建站咨詢

